Windows XP pro: Epson perfection scanner 2400 Photo. I have been trying to
scan some photographs. Each time, I get an error - Scan assistant:
Insufficient memory or disc space. When I close the error box, all copies
are deleted. What do I do to access more disc space? I have restarted my
computer, deleted all cookies, temp files and history.

I am scanning at 150 dpi. Is that too high? 150 dpi seems to be the
default setting.

No, 150 DPI is not too high....I usually
scan color prints at 300 DPI.

The following Epson document suggests
reinstalling the Epson software.

My scanner software
doesn't work properly. Why?
